The story of Ada Maud Wadsworth began in 1894 in Appleton, Knox, Maine, USA. In 1900, Ada Maud Wadsworth resided in Appleton, Knox, Maine, USA. In 1910, Ada Maud Wadsworth resided in Appleton, Knox, Maine, USA. Ada Maud Wadsworth married Albert Frank Barnes, and had children including Alberta Wadsworth Barnes, Alice Edna Barnes, Donald Maynard Barnes. Ada Maud Wadsworth passed away in 1940 in Morrill, Waldo County, Maine, USA.
